Mountain biking around Grad Buje offers diverse terrain across rolling hills, fertile land, and a Mediterranean climate, characterized by vineyards and olive groves. The region features a network of both paved and off-road cycling paths, including sections of the historic Parenzana Trail. Riders can expect varied topography, from gentle countryside paths to routes with significant elevation changes, providing panoramic views of the Adriatic Sea and surrounding landscapes. The area's geomorphological features, including karst formations, contribute to a unique natural environment for outdoor sports.

Grad Buje offers a diverse network of over 25 mountain bike trails. These routes cater to various skill levels, including 6 easy, 18 moderate, and 3 difficult options, ensuring there's something for every rider.
The terrain around Grad Buje is characterized by rolling hills, extensive vineyards, and olive groves, set against a Mediterranean climate. You'll find a mix of paved and off-road paths, including sections of the historic Parenzana Trail. The region's unique geomorphological features, such as karst formations, add to the varied landscape, with some routes offering significant elevation changes and panoramic coastal views.
Yes, Grad Buje has several easy mountain bike trails perfect for beginners or those looking for a relaxed ride. One such option is the Parenzana Tunnel Sv. Vid – Old Grožnjan Railway Station loop from Buje, which is 8.5 miles (13.7 km) long and takes about 52 minutes to complete. Another easy route is the Stone Arch Bridge – Parenzana Railway Trail loop from Buje, covering 10.6 miles (17.0 km) in about 1 hour 11 minutes.
For experienced riders seeking a challenge, Grad Buje offers several longer and more demanding routes. The Saletto Tunnel – Valeta Tunnel loop from Buje is a difficult 38.9 miles (62.6 km) path with significant elevation gain, taking approximately 4 hours 47 minutes. Another substantial ride is the Buje Old Town – Historic village of Grožnjan loop from Buje, a moderate 32.0 miles (51.5 km) route that connects two charming Istrian hilltop towns.
Many trails offer access to the region's rich history and natural beauty. You can explore the charming Buje Old Town, with its medieval architecture and panoramic views. The Parenzana Trail itself is a historic attraction, featuring old railway tunnels and bridges. You might also encounter the Škarlina Canyon Nature Park or the Momjan Castle Ruins on some routes.
The Mediterranean climate of Grad Buje makes spring and autumn ideal for mountain biking. During these seasons, the weather is typically mild and pleasant, perfect for exploring the trails without the intense heat of summer. The vineyards and olive groves are particularly beautiful during these times, offering stunning scenery.
Yes, many mountain bike trails in Grad Buje are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. Popular circular routes include the Buje Old Town – Historic village of Grožnjan loop from Buje and the Saletto Tunnel – Valeta Tunnel loop from Buje. These loops provide a convenient way to explore the region's diverse landscapes.
While specific family-friendly designations vary, the easier trails in Grad Buje, particularly sections of the Parenzana Trail, are generally suitable for families with older children. These routes often have less elevation gain and smoother surfaces. Always check the difficulty grade and distance of a route, such as the Parenzana Tunnel Sv. Vid – Old Grožnjan Railway Station loop from Buje, to ensure it matches your family's abilities.
Many outdoor trails in Grad Buje are dog-friendly, but it's always recommended to keep your dog on a leash, especially in populated areas or near wildlife. Be mindful of other trail users and ensure your dog is well-behaved. Always carry water for your pet, particularly on longer rides.
Parking is generally available in and around Grad Buje, particularly near the town center or at designated trailheads. Many routes, such as those starting from Buje, offer convenient access to parking facilities. It's advisable to check local signage for specific parking regulations and availability.
Yes, the Grad Buje region is dotted with charming towns and villages where you can find cafes, restaurants, and local taverns. Routes that pass through or near towns like Grožnjan or Buje Old Town offer opportunities to stop for refreshments and experience local Istrian cuisine. The Buje Old Town – Historic village of Grožnjan loop from Buje is a good example of a route connecting two such towns.
